Iron deficiency is one of the most common nutritional deficiencies in the world, and if you have low iron levels, excessive tea consumption can aggravate your condition. Due to which there may also be a lack of iron in your body.
The tannins in tea leaves are responsible for the bitter, dry taste of tea; the astringent nature of tannins can also irritate digestive tissue, causing nausea or stomach pain and causing you to feel nauseous. Therefore, this tea should not be consumed on an empty stomach as some compounds in the tea can cause nausea, especially when consumed in large quantities or on an empty stomach.
The caffeine in tea can cause heartburn or aggravate pre-existing symptoms of acid reflux.

What is Milk Tea and How to make Milk Tea
What is Milk Tea

Milk tea is a delicious mixture of milk, sugar, black tea which is very much liked by the people. This tea is consumed in great quantity as this tea is very easy to make and it does not require much ingredients nor does it take much time to make.
Ingredients
- 250 ml Milk
- 2 tbsp Sugar
- 1 tbsp Tea Powder
- cardamom
- Ginger
How to make Milk Tea At Home
- First of all take a pan and boil half a cup of water in it.
- Now add sugar, tea powder to it.
- Add cardamom and ginger to it.
- Let it cook for 5 to 6 minutes.
- Now add half a cup of milk to it and boil it for 5 to 6 minutes.
- Now strain the tea in a cup
- Now your tea is ready, you can enjoy it.
